Home
last modified time | relevance | path

Searched refs:ShaderSpec (Results 1 – 23 of 23) sorted by relevance

/external/deqp/external/vulkancts/modules/vulkan/shaderexecutor/
DvktShaderExecutor.hpp51 struct ShaderSpec struct
60 ShaderSpec (void) in ShaderSpec() argument
81 ShaderExecutor (Context& context, const ShaderSpec& shaderSpec) in ShaderExecutor()
87 const ShaderSpec m_shaderSpec;
94 void generateSources (glu::ShaderType shaderType, const ShaderSpec& shaderSpec, vk::SourceColle…
95 ShaderExecutor* createExecutor (Context& context, glu::ShaderType shaderType, const ShaderSpec& s…
DvktShaderExecutor.cpp122 static std::string generateVertexShader (const ShaderSpec& shaderSpec, const std::string& inputPref… in generateVertexShader()
204 static void generateFragShaderOutputDecl (std::ostream& src, const ShaderSpec& shaderSpec, bool use… in generateFragShaderOutputDecl()
253 static void generateFragShaderOutAssign (std::ostream& src, const ShaderSpec& shaderSpec, bool useI… in generateFragShaderOutAssign()
281 static std::string generatePassthroughFragmentShader (const ShaderSpec& shaderSpec, bool useIntOutp… in generatePassthroughFragmentShader()
316 static std::string generateGeometryShader (const ShaderSpec& shaderSpec, const std::string& inputPr… in generateGeometryShader()
399 static std::string generateFragmentShader (const ShaderSpec& shaderSpec, bool useIntOutputs, const … in generateFragmentShader()
443 …FragmentOutExecutor (Context& context, glu::ShaderType shaderType, const ShaderSpec& shaderSpec, …
495 …agmentOutExecutor (Context& context, glu::ShaderType shaderType, const ShaderSpec& shaderSpec, VkD… in FragmentOutExecutor()
1409 …VertexShaderExecutor (Context& context, const ShaderSpec& shaderSpec, VkDescriptorSetLayout extraR…
1412 static void generateSources (const ShaderSpec& shaderSpec, SourceCollections& dst);
[all …]
DvktShaderIntegerFunctionTests.cpp335 ShaderSpec m_spec;
356 …tionTestInstance (Context& context, glu::ShaderType shaderType, const ShaderSpec& spec, int numVa… in IntegerFunctionTestInstance()
373 ShaderSpec m_spec;
454 …UaddCarryCaseInstance (Context& context, glu::ShaderType shaderType, const ShaderSpec& spec, int n… in UaddCarryCaseInstance()
564 …UsubBorrowCaseInstance (Context& context, glu::ShaderType shaderType, const ShaderSpec& spec, int … in UsubBorrowCaseInstance()
672 …UmulExtendedCaseInstance (Context& context, glu::ShaderType shaderType, const ShaderSpec& spec, in… in UmulExtendedCaseInstance()
776 …ImulExtendedCaseInstance (Context& context, glu::ShaderType shaderType, const ShaderSpec& spec, in… in ImulExtendedCaseInstance()
881 …BitfieldExtractCaseInstance (Context& context, glu::ShaderType shaderType, const ShaderSpec& spec,… in BitfieldExtractCaseInstance()
958 …BitfieldInsertCaseInstance (Context& context, glu::ShaderType shaderType, const ShaderSpec& spec, … in BitfieldInsertCaseInstance()
1040 …BitfieldReverseCaseInstance (Context& context, glu::ShaderType shaderType, const ShaderSpec& spec,… in BitfieldReverseCaseInstance()
[all …]
DvktShaderCommonFunctionTests.cpp460 ShaderSpec m_spec;
480 …ctionTestInstance (Context& context, glu::ShaderType shaderType, const ShaderSpec& spec, int numVa… in CommonFunctionTestInstance()
496 const ShaderSpec m_spec;
578 …AbsCaseInstance (Context& context, glu::ShaderType shaderType, const ShaderSpec& spec, int numValu… in AbsCaseInstance()
674 …SignCaseInstance (Context& context, glu::ShaderType shaderType, const ShaderSpec& spec, int numVal… in SignCaseInstance()
794 …RoundEvenCaseInstance (Context& context, glu::ShaderType shaderType, const ShaderSpec& spec, int n… in RoundEvenCaseInstance()
919 …ModfCaseInstance (Context& context, glu::ShaderType shaderType, const ShaderSpec& spec, int numVal… in ModfCaseInstance()
999 …IsnanCaseInstance (Context& context, glu::ShaderType shaderType, const ShaderSpec& spec, int numVa… in IsnanCaseInstance()
1096 …IsinfCaseInstance (Context& context, glu::ShaderType shaderType, const ShaderSpec& spec, int numVa… in IsinfCaseInstance()
1194 …FloatBitsToUintIntCaseInstance (Context& context, glu::ShaderType shaderType, const ShaderSpec& sp… in FloatBitsToUintIntCaseInstance()
[all …]
DvktShaderPackingFunctionTests.cpp112 ShaderSpec m_spec;
134 …ctionTestInstance (Context& context, glu::ShaderType shaderType, const ShaderSpec& spec, const cha… in ShaderPackingFunctionTestInstance()
147 ShaderSpec m_spec;
157 …PackSnorm2x16CaseInstance (Context& context, glu::ShaderType shaderType, const ShaderSpec& spec, g… in PackSnorm2x16CaseInstance()
279 …UnpackSnorm2x16CaseInstance (Context& context, glu::ShaderType shaderType, const ShaderSpec& spec,… in UnpackSnorm2x16CaseInstance()
380 …PackUnorm2x16CaseInstance (Context& context, glu::ShaderType shaderType, const ShaderSpec& spec, g… in PackUnorm2x16CaseInstance()
502 …UnpackUnorm2x16CaseInstance (Context& context, glu::ShaderType shaderType, const ShaderSpec& spec,… in UnpackUnorm2x16CaseInstance()
605 …PackHalf2x16CaseInstance (Context& context, glu::ShaderType shaderType, const ShaderSpec& spec, co… in PackHalf2x16CaseInstance()
726 …UnpackHalf2x16CaseInstance (Context& context, glu::ShaderType shaderType, const ShaderSpec& spec, … in UnpackHalf2x16CaseInstance()
851 …PackSnorm4x8CaseInstance (Context& context, glu::ShaderType shaderType, const ShaderSpec& spec, gl… in PackSnorm4x8CaseInstance()
[all …]
DvktOpaqueTypeIndexingTests.cpp190 ShaderSpec m_shaderSpec;
214 const ShaderSpec& shaderSpec,
227 const ShaderSpec& m_shaderSpec;
234 const ShaderSpec& shaderSpec, in OpaqueTypeIndexingTestInstance()
723 const ShaderSpec& shaderSpec,
739 const ShaderSpec& shaderSpec, in SamplerIndexingCaseInstance()
1233 const ShaderSpec& shaderSpec,
1253 const ShaderSpec& shaderSpec, in BlockArrayIndexingCaseInstance()
1604 const ShaderSpec& shaderSpec,
1618 const ShaderSpec& shaderSpec, in AtomicCounterIndexingCaseInstance()
DvktShaderBuiltinPrecisionTests.cpp4386 const ShaderSpec& shaderSpec, in BuiltinPrecisionCaseTestInstance()
4622 ShaderSpec m_spec;
/external/deqp/modules/glshared/
DglsShaderExecUtil.cpp94 static std::string generateVertexShader (const ShaderSpec& shaderSpec, const std::string& inputPref… in generateVertexShader()
171 static std::string generateGeometryShader (const ShaderSpec& shaderSpec, const std::string& inputPr… in generateGeometryShader()
270 static std::string generatePassthroughVertexShader (const ShaderSpec& shaderSpec, const std::string… in generatePassthroughVertexShader()
298 static void generateFragShaderOutputDecl (std::ostream& src, const ShaderSpec& shaderSpec, bool use… in generateFragShaderOutputDecl()
349 static void generateFragShaderOutAssign (std::ostream& src, const ShaderSpec& shaderSpec, bool useI… in generateFragShaderOutAssign()
377 static std::string generateFragmentShader (const ShaderSpec& shaderSpec, bool useIntOutputs, const … in generateFragmentShader()
419 static std::string generatePassthroughFragmentShader (const ShaderSpec& shaderSpec, bool useIntOutp… in generatePassthroughFragmentShader()
457 ShaderExecutor::ShaderExecutor (const glu::RenderContext& renderCtx, const ShaderSpec& shaderSpec) in ShaderExecutor()
485 FragmentOutExecutor (const glu::RenderContext& renderCtx, const ShaderSpec& shaderSpec);
520 FragmentOutExecutor::FragmentOutExecutor (const glu::RenderContext& renderCtx, const ShaderSpec& sh… in FragmentOutExecutor()
[all …]
DglsShaderExecUtil.hpp58 struct ShaderSpec struct
66 ShaderSpec (void) : version(glu::GLSL_VERSION_300_ES) {} in ShaderSpec() argument
91 ShaderExecutor (const glu::RenderContext& renderCtx, const ShaderSpec& shaderSpec);
102 …or (const glu::RenderContext& renderCtx, glu::ShaderType shaderType, const ShaderSpec& shaderSpec);
DglsBuiltinPrecisionTests.cpp4483 ShaderSpec spec; in testStatement()
/external/deqp/modules/gles31/functional/
Des31fOpaqueTypeIndexingTests.cpp345 …void getShaderSpec (ShaderSpec* spec, int numSamplers, int numLookups, const int* lookupInd…
395 void SamplerIndexingCase::getShaderSpec (ShaderSpec* spec, int numSamplers, int numLookups, const i… in getShaderSpec()
500 ShaderSpec shaderSpec; in iterate()
715 …void getShaderSpec (ShaderSpec* spec, int numInstances, int numReads, const int* readIndic…
780 void BlockArrayIndexingCase::getShaderSpec (ShaderSpec* spec, int numInstances, int numReads, const… in getShaderSpec()
849 ShaderSpec shaderSpec; in iterate()
947 …void getShaderSpec (ShaderSpec* spec, int numCounters, int numOps, const int* opIndices, …
1015 void AtomicCounterIndexingCase::getShaderSpec (ShaderSpec* spec, int numCounters, int numOps, const… in getShaderSpec()
1078 ShaderSpec shaderSpec; in iterate()
Des31fShaderBuiltinConstantTests.cpp195 ShaderSpec shaderSpec; in createGetConstantExecutor()
Des31fShaderIntegerFunctionTests.cpp180 ShaderSpec m_spec;
Des31fShaderPackingFunctionTests.cpp80 ShaderSpec m_spec;
Des31fShaderCommonFunctionTests.cpp255 ShaderSpec m_spec;
/external/deqp/external/vulkancts/modules/vulkan/ycbcr/
DvktYCbCrFormatTests.cpp259 ShaderSpec getShaderSpec (const TestParameters&) in getShaderSpec()
261 ShaderSpec spec; in getShaderSpec()
473 const ShaderSpec spec = getShaderSpec(params); in initPrograms()
DvktYCbCrViewTests.cpp411 ShaderSpec getShaderSpec (const TestParameters&) in getShaderSpec()
413 ShaderSpec spec; in getShaderSpec()
708 const ShaderSpec spec = getShaderSpec(params); in initPrograms()
DvktYCbCrImageQueryTests.cpp104 ShaderSpec getShaderSpec (const TestParameters& params) in getShaderSpec()
106 ShaderSpec spec; in getShaderSpec()
673 const ShaderSpec spec = getShaderSpec(params); in initImageQueryPrograms()
DvktYCbCrConversionTests.cpp596 ShaderSpec createShaderSpec (void) in createShaderSpec()
598 ShaderSpec spec; in createShaderSpec()
1828 const ShaderSpec spec (createShaderSpec()); in evalShader()
2278 const ShaderSpec spec (createShaderSpec()); in createTestShaders()
2283 ShaderSpec spec; in createTestShaders()
/external/deqp/external/vulkancts/modules/vulkan/texture/
DvktTextureFilteringExplicitLodTests.cpp648 const ShaderSpec& shaderSpec,
663 const ShaderSpec m_shaderSpec;
691 const ShaderSpec& shaderSpec, in TextureFilteringTestInstance()
1084 ShaderSpec m_shaderSpec;
/external/deqp/modules/gles3/functional/
Des3fShaderPackingFunctionTests.cpp80 ShaderSpec m_spec;
Des3fShaderBuiltinVarTests.cpp118 ShaderSpec shaderSpec; in createGetConstantExecutor()
Des3fShaderCommonFunctionTests.cpp182 ShaderSpec m_spec;